java 连接 2008_JDBC连接SqlServer2008图解:直连(纯JAVA方式)

[首先下载JDBC:下载地址:http://www.microsoft.com/zh-cn/download/details.aspxid=21599下载 完成后,是个exe文件,点击运行,会提示你选择解压目录:如下图:点击Brows

一、使用纯Java方式连接数据库

由JDBC驱动直接访问数据库

优点:100% Java,快又可跨平台

缺点:访问不同的数据库需要下载专用的JDBC驱动

892befac738c160b96b9378db28829e2.gif

8b52387d3c65fef50f6dae4c3a5242e1.gif

[   sqlserver2008的连接,用sqlserver2005的jar包sqljdbc.jar或者sqljdbc4.jar均可以,连接字符串与sqlserver2005的写法一样。 设置过程如下: 1. web-inf\fcconfig.xml

二、下载JDBC驱动

解压缩后,把sqljdbc4.jar包导入到项目中。

三、测试连接

import java.sql.Connection; import java.sql.DriverManager; import java.sql.SQLException; import org.apache.log4j.Logger; /** * 使用JDBC的纯Java方式建立数据库连接并关闭。与使用JDBC-ODBC桥方式建立 * 数据库连接相比,需要修改JDBC驱动类字符串和URL字符串。 * @author */ public class TestLog1 { private static Logger logger = Logger.getLogger(TestLog1.class.getName()); public static void main(String[] args) { Connection conn = null; // 1、加载驱动 try { Class.forName("com.microsoft.sqlserver.jdbc.SQLServerDriver"); } catch (ClassNotFoundException e) { e.printStackTrace(); logger.error(e); } // 2、建立连接 try { conn = DriverManager.getConnection( "jdbc:sqlserver://localhost:1433;databaseName=MyTest", "sa", "123456"); System.out.println("建立连接成功!"); } catch (SQLException e) { logger.error(e); e.printStackTrace(); } finally { // 3、关闭连接 try { if (null != conn) { conn.close(); System.out.println("关闭连接成功!"); } } catch (SQLException e) { logger.error(e); e.printStackTrace(); } } } }

[java语言中,通过jdbc访问sqlserver2005数据库默认实例可以按正常的写法来建立url连接,代码如下:Connection cn = DriverManager.getConnection(jdbc:sqlserver://172.16

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值